Crane outrigger stabilizer pads serve a critical role in distributing the load from the crane's outriggers. These pads increase the contact area between the outrigger and the ground, lowering the pressure exerted on the surface and reducing the risk of sinking or tipping. Choosing the right pad can significantly enhance the overall stability of your lifting operations.

The size of the stabilizer pads should complement your crane's outriggers. Larger pads can provide better stability by distributing the weight over a broader surface area. Additionally, thicker pads tend to hold up better under extreme conditions. Measure your outriggers and consider the type of terrain where you’ll be working to determine the appropriate size and thickness.
Each pad has a specific weight capacity. It's crucial to select stabilizer pads that can handle the maximum load of your crane under various lifting scenarios. Overloading a pad can lead to failure, compromising both safety and the integrity of your lifting operations.
Different job sites present unique challenges. If you're working on soft or uneven ground, consider pads specifically designed for those conditions. Some pads feature additional design elements, like grooves or inserts, that enhance grip and stability in tricky terrains.
